Dot Net Full Stack
In the rapidly evolving domain of web and enterprise software development, full stack developers are in high demand for their ability to manage both frontend and backend development with seamless integration. Among the various full stack technologies, DotNet Full Stack stands out due to its robustness, performance, and enterprise-grade capabilities. The DotNet Full Stack Classes in Ireland have grown in popularity due to the country's burgeoning IT industry and a growing need for versatile software engineers who can manage complex systems efficiently.
This comprehensive article will discuss in detail what DotNet Full Stack development involves, the technologies you’ll master, the career advantages of pursuing a structured program, and why Ireland is an emerging hub for such technical training. In addition, it also elaborates on the curriculum framework offered by SevenMentor the best training institute for DotNet Full Stack Training, providing a clear roadmap for learners aspiring to build expertise in this domain.
Understanding DotNet Full Stack Development
DotNet Full Stack development is the integrated use of Microsoft's.NET framework for backend programming, as well as current frontend frameworks and databases, to create full online applications. This method allows developers to work on both server-side logic and client-side UI using integrated technologies.
On the backend, developers use ASP.NET Core or classic ASP.NET MVC, C# for business logic, and Entity Framework for data operations. Frontend technologies like HTML5, CSS3, JavaScript, and frameworks like Angular or React are used to develop responsive and dynamic user interfaces. DotNet Full Stack developers also use Microsoft SQL Server or Azure SQL Database to manage permanent data storage.
By enrolling in DotNet Full Stack courses in Ireland, learners gain a comprehensive understanding of each technology layer, including deployment and version control using tools like Git, DevOps pipelines, and cloud deployment on Microsoft Azure.
Curriculum Structure and Technical Coverage
The structured curriculum of DotNet Full Stack training in Ireland at SevenMentor is designed to provide in-depth technical knowledge and hands-on experience with real-world projects. A typical program spans several months and is broken into modular components that cover each layer of the stack:
1. Backend Programming with .NET and C#
Students begin by mastering the fundamentals of object-oriented programming (OOP) using C#. The course explores the syntax, inheritance, interfaces, exception handling, and memory management. This forms the backbone for developing scalable and maintainable backend systems.
Following this, ASP.NET Core is introduced, where students learn to build RESTful APIs, manage HTTP requests, and implement routing, authentication, and authorization mechanisms. The integration of middleware components, configuration setups, and dependency injection patterns are thoroughly covered.
2. Frontend Development Using JavaScript and Frameworks
Modern frontend design is not limited to basic HTML and CSS. Full stack students dive into advanced JavaScript techniques, asynchronous programming with AJAX, DOM manipulation, and event-driven programming. Learners then progress to using frontend libraries like Angular or React to build single-page applications (SPA) with component-based architecture and state management.
This segment ensures that students not only build beautiful UI but also understand user experience (UX) design principles and responsive design practices for compatibility across devices.
3. Database Integration and ORM with Entity Framework
Understanding relational databases is essential in any enterprise-grade application. Students learn T-SQL, stored procedures, views, and indexing in SQL Server. The training continues with Entity Framework (EF Core), where developers learn how to perform CRUD operations using LINQ queries, manage migrations, and establish entity relationships in code-first and database-first approaches.
This holistic approach ensures that learners can seamlessly integrate and maintain data-driven applications with .NET backends.
4. DevOps, Git, and Cloud Deployment
The curriculum also introduces version control using Git and GitHub, which is crucial for team-based development. CI/CD pipelines are built using Azure DevOps or GitHub Actions. Finally, learners deploy applications on Microsoft Azure, setting up App Services, configuring load balancers, and managing scalability and performance metrics.
This final module ensures developers can move from code to production independently and securely.
Career Scope and Industry Relevance in Ireland
Ireland has established itself as a prime destination for global tech giants and a growing hub for startups and enterprise IT. With companies adopting modern digital infrastructure and microservice-based architectures, the demand for full stack developers has seen a consistent rise.
Professionals trained through structured DotNet Full Stack Classes in Ireland are positioned to fulfill various roles such as Full Stack Developer, Backend .NET Developer, Software Engineer – Web Applications, DevOps-integrated Developer, Azure Cloud Developer.
These roles span across industries such as fintech, healthcare, government systems, supply chain, and more. DotNet’s compatibility with Windows environments, enterprise-level integrations, and Microsoft’s strong partner ecosystem make it an indispensable tool for Ireland’s software infrastructure.
Why Choose SevenMentor for DotNet Full Stack Training?
SevenMentor, the best training institute for DotNet Full Stack Training has earned a reputation for delivering structured, industry-aligned, and technically rigorous training programs. Their training methodology includes expert mentorship, project-based learning, regular assessments, and certification preparation.
Students enrolled in the program benefit from real-time project experience involving inventory systems, customer relationship management (CRM) portals, and e-commerce platforms. The blend of theory and practice ensures mastery over each technology and its integration.
Moreover, SevenMentor’s training is updated frequently to include the latest versions of .NET, changes in the C# language, advancements in Angular/React, and Azure cloud deployment strategies. This forward-thinking approach prepares learners for real-world job requirements.
Project Work and Capstone Assignments
One of the unique features of DotNet Full Stack courses in Ireland is the emphasis on practical implementation through capstone projects. These include Building a microservices-based e-commerce application, Developing an internal HR management system,
Creating a customer support ticketing system with role-based access, Building RESTful APIs with secure JWT authentication, Deploying web applications using CI/CD pipelines to Azure.
Through these assignments, students demonstrate their command over the full stack and gain confidence for job interviews and technical assessments.
Advantages of Structured Full Stack Training
The comprehensive training provided through DotNet Full Stack training in Ireland offers significant advantages over self-learning or unstructured tutorials. It includes Guidance from experienced industry professionals, Dedicated doubt-solving sessions and live coding practices,
Real-time collaboration through Git workflows, Code reviews, performance optimization, and best practice implementation, Professional resume-building and interview preparation sessions.
Graduates of SevenMentor’s program have been successfully placed in leading Irish and international companies, thanks to their strong foundational knowledge and job-ready skills.
By enrolling in DotNet Full Stack Classes in Ireland, students not only acquire in-demand programming expertise but also prepare themselves for dynamic roles across the software development lifecycle. Whether building high-performance APIs or deploying on the cloud, DotNet Full Stack developers stand at the forefront of digital transformation in enterprises.
Those seeking to build a strong technical career can confidently rely on SevenMentor the best training institute for DotNet Full Stack Training to guide their journey from beginner to industry professional. The course’s practical focus, expert mentors, and placement assistance make it one of the most comprehensive options available.
Online Classes
SevenMentor offers in-depth online DotNet Full Stack training that maintains the same level of depth and engagement. The online DotNet Full Stack courses in Ireland are conducted through live virtual classrooms, ensuring real-time interaction with instructors. Students have access to recorded sessions, coding assignments, cloud labs, and mentorship support.
The online model is particularly useful for working professionals, university students, and international learners. Despite the geographical flexibility, the online program maintains high technical standards, industry relevance, and certification preparation. Students can access the course portal 24/7, allowing self-paced learning alongside scheduled live classes.
Corporate Training
SevenMentor also offers customized corporate DotNet Full Stack training in Ireland for corporations seeking to upskill their development teams. These corporate programs are tailored to meet specific organizational needs, project environments, and tech stacks.
Training modules are delivered on-site or online, depending on the client’s preference. Through real-world project integration and collaborative problem-solving, employees develop a deeper understanding of full stack development. With SevenMentor’s expertise in enterprise training, companies benefit from enhanced productivity, better code quality, and faster project turnaround times.
Corporates across domains such as finance, healthcare, education, and logistics have partnered with SevenMentor the best training institute for DotNet Full Stack Training to build agile and future-ready developer teams.